Riverdale Country School (RCS) is an independent coeducational day school located in the Bronx, New York. Founded in 1907, Riverdale is one of the region’s premier academic and athletic institutions, competing in the Ivy Preparatory League. The school enrolls over 1,000 students from Pre-K through Grade 12, with a strong tradition of academic excellence, community leadership, and competitive athletics.


Riverdale’s boys basketball program has developed into one of New York City’s most respected high school programs. Known for its balance of toughness, intelligence, and unselfish play, the team consistently produces college-level talent and competes against some of the top programs in the metropolitan area. In addition to Ivy League play, The Falcons prepare for their winter campaign by playing in elite preseason showcases and scrimmages across the Tri-state region.

The team is head coached by Brendan Barile, a son of a high school coach, a former college player at City College of New York, and former player, a coach and a player-coach in international play.

Ryder Rasch (2026) 6’1 point guard — A dynamic guard who impacts the game on both ends, Rasch is a high-level scorer and playmaker with an advanced feel for tempo and spacing. He attacks gaps, finishes through contact, and consistently creates advantages off the dribble. Defensively, he sets the tone with his on-ball pressure and communication. Plays AAU with NY ETA.  High gpa


Keertan Sawtell (2026) 6’2 point guard — A high-IQ floor general who does everything well. Sawtell is a true leader, organizing both ends of the floor with composure and toughness. He plays with pace, values possessions, and raises the level of everyone around him. His decision-making and command make him one of the steadiest guards in the league. Plays AAU with NY ETA. High gpa


Nolan Weathers (2026) 6’2 wing — A three-level scorer and elite defender committed to Wesleyan University. Weathers brings intensity, poise, and versatility, thriving as a lockdown perimeter defender while providing consistent offensive production. He spaces the floor with confidence and plays with a professional approach on both ends. Plays AAU with NY ETA. High gpa


Jack Moynahan (2026) 6’6 wing — A long, tough, and skilled shooter who anchors the team’s spacing. Moynahan averaged 8 rebounds per game and hit 40% from three as a junior, bringing a rare combination of rebounding, toughness, and marksmanship. Plays AAU with Riverside Select. High gpa


Harry Alper (2026) 6’3 wing — A do-it-all player who defends, rebounds, and facilitates. Alper contributes across every statistical category and has the versatility to guard multiple positions. His IQ and willingness to do the little things make him a winning piece in every lineup. Plays AAU with ABC Basketball. High gpa


Charles Lipshultz (2026) 5’9 guard — An incredibly skilled scoring guard who can take over a game with his shot creation and competitiveness. When he adds rebounding and playmaking to his scoring, he looks like the best player on the floor. Plays AAU with Good NRGY. High gpa


Casey Karsch (2027) 6’4 forward — A relentless rebounder who led the league in offensive boards as a sophomore. Karsch combines toughness and athleticism with emerging shooting touch, projecting significant upside as a stretch forward. Plays AAU with ABC Basketball. High gpa


Jack Rodriguez (2027) 5’9 guard — A tough, fearless guard and microwave scorer from deep. Rodriguez competes with confidence and is capable of catching fire quickly. His scoring ability and edge make him a spark plug for the Falcons. Plays AAU with 6th Boro Hoops. High gpa


Jake Liston (2028) 6’2 wing — An athletic, versatile young wing who impacts every possession. Liston defends, rebounds, and attacks the rim with energy beyond his years, making him one of the most promising underclassmen in the program. Plays AAU with NY Rens. High gpa
